A couple weeks ago I ordered Black Wax on Amazon because it was out of stock. Due to being out of stock, they had a great price of nine dollars and change. I think it's in the same status now. It said it could take 1-2 months to ship.
However, to my surprise today a little box came with Black Wax inside!
I was cleaning my black car as it arrived, so I immediately applied black wax! Fun!
Honestly, it's a bit hard for me to review a wax. I will share all I can. Application is easy. I feel you're tempted to overuse the product slightly with the toothpaste style. Nevertheless, the overuse did not have any negative effect. Being a perfectionist, I am somewhat disappointed that the tube gets all wrinkled up like a toothpaste from squeezing on it, even if you're careful to work your way from the back light toothpaste. Indeed, it actually gets more wrinkly than the toothpaste I use.
The paste has a somewhat dark look to it. It didn't seem as fragrant as NXT, Gold Class, etc. but the scent was pleasant nevertheless. Not sure what the scent is, perhaps a very light buttery blackberry.
I cleaned my windows as it continued to haze, and then wiped off easily. It removed as easy as the easiest Meguiar's waxes I have used. No worry about any streaking, etc. like with some of the fully synthetic products. It removed similar to Gold Class.
The finish? The polishing oils are oh so present. It leaves that great, deep, black appearance. Furthermore, it is smooth to the touch and great clarity. The look is good, but then again, lots of polish on a black car is always going to look striking.
My verdict? A quality product. For the average joe at the store shopping, they will be satisfied buying the black wax for his or her dark car as the polish will no doubt wow their eyes. Furthermore, the paste was fairly fun to apply, though slightly more awkward to hold than a tub or a liquid bottle.
My only question comes to longevity. Gold Class also has some great polishing effect, but it's not terribly long lasting. I do not yet know how long lasting Black Wax is going to be. Furthermore, the packaging and tube doesn't seem to stress any particular wax/protection strengths. It's clear it protects, but how does that protection compare to other Meguiar's products?
Overall, awesome application and removal, awesome look on finish. However, I am uncertain the type and quality of protection I have applied to the vehicle.
